In Oct 2019, Koons unveiled a fresh statue in Paris, called Bouquet of Tulips. Commissioned by the previous United States Ambassador to France it was intended to become a memorial to those who dropped their lives while in the 2015 and 2016 terror assaults in the town. Featuring a hand that emerges from the ground and clutches a spray of balloon bouquets, paying homage to his previously operate Tulips, the piece has actually been beset by controversy. When the undertaking was initial outlined in 2016, customers from the French cultural institution published an open up letter from the everyday newspaper Liberation contacting the piece, "opportunistic and in many cases cynical" and requesting that the plan was cancelled.

Not everyone has actually been on board with Koons mania, nevertheless. French artists and arts pros spoke out from Koons’s proposal to get a Parisian monument towards the victims with the 2015 terrorist attacks within the French funds.
